This Christmas time is so very different than the last three. Christmas is my favorite time of year and this year has been so much fun. Kaylee is really starting to understand what it is all about.
While at the post office last week she befriended an older man in the long line with her charm and funny disposition. His full attention was toward her and she knew it. So she started asking him if he knew God and Jesus? My heart sunk immediately as I was nervous for him to get scared away. When he said he knew them a little bit she proceeded to ask him if he knew what Jesus did for him? He said no. So she told him Jesus died on the cross for his sins and that He loves him very much. Then she just wouldn't let him off the hook...next was "do you go to church?" He sheepishly said no and she put her hands on her hip and said "why not?" This is where I started freaking out. I gently said "lets not grill the man". But he was not afraid of this little girl and was not scared away either. It really was a sweet conversation and I will never forget hearing my 5 year old witness to a stranger. The funny thing is I would never have done what she did, for obvious reasons. But the innocence and love from this little girl flowed out that day and I am pretty sure she blessed the man who held her attention the short 10 minutes we were in the post office that day.
This is what Christmas is about, not being afraid to focus on the reason it ever began.
